A proxy server acts as a middle layer between your device and a website. Instead of connecting directly, your requests go through another machine, so the destination sees a different IP address. Proxy servers differ by protocol (HTTP, HTTPS, SOCKS, and CGI) and by IP version (IPv4 vs. IPv6), which can affect compatibility with your tools and targets.

Proxy basics: what you’re actually buying
Proxy server
A proxy server is a routing layer. It routes traffic through an intermediate endpoint and can rotate IPs on a schedule or per request, so the destination sees a different IP than your original one.
Residential proxies
These exits come from consumer internet proxy providers. They usually behave more like “regular user” traffic, which can help on sites that aggressively filter hosting IPs. The tradeoff is cost: residential bandwidth is typically pricier.
Datacenter proxies
These are server-based IPs from the hosting infrastructure. They’re common for fast, high-volume jobs because they’re cheap at scale, but stricter targets can identify them sooner.

ISP proxies (static residential)
Think of these as “stable residential-style” IPs. They resemble consumer ISP addresses, but are delivered in a more consistent way, making them a frequent choice for long sessions and sticky use cases.
Which proxy type fits the job
- Scraping, price tracking, and e-commerce monitoring
Residential proxies are often the safer route when sites restrict or filter hosting IPs. Optimize for consistency: success rate, stable response times, and predictable rotation matter more than the biggest advertised pool.
- Multi-account workflows and social platforms
Mobile proxies plus ISP proxies are commonly used when session stability is the priority. Mobile exits can reduce friction on certain platforms, while ISP proxies are usually picked when you need the same IP to hold for longer.
- Ad verification and location-based QA
Residential or ISP proxies with precise targeting are ideal here. If you test ads or SERPs, look for city-level controls and, if possible, ZIP and ASN targeting for accuracy.
- High-volume crawling and bulk checks
Datacenter proxies are the usual choice when you care about speed and cost per request. If budgeting is a pain point, choose products that transparently advertise unlimited bandwidth on that exact proxy plan.
Why you shouldn’t use free proxy servers
- Man-in-the-middle and traffic interception risk: If the operator controls the proxy server, they can potentially monitor, log, or even alter traffic. MITM is a standard threat model, especially when users assume a proxy automatically makes browsing safer. Many free proxies fail basic security expectations, including cases where HTTPS isn’t supported, which can leave sessions without proper encryption.
- Data leakage and credential reuse: Free proxies are commonly shared and inconsistent, which makes session leakage more likely. They can also push users into risky habits like reusing passwords or relying on cookies while assuming the proxy protects them.
- Malware and proxyware ecosystems: “Free” often means the service is monetized by selling bandwidth or turning devices into part of someone else’s IP. This creates uncertain consent chains and a higher security risk.
- Compliance and reputation damage: Shared exit IP addresses are frequently abused and can get flagged, which breaks scraping, automation, and even normal browsing. Paid proxy providers are not perfect, but they usually publish policies, offer controls, and provide support channels.
